**Until Koa, the multistep reasoning behind Salesforce's agents ran on Claude or ChatGPT.**

Salesforce and Nvidia announced [Koa](https://salesforce.com/koa?ref=metatalks.ai) at Dreamforce. It is available to select pilot customers through Agentforce, Salesforce's platform for building AI agents, where a gateway picks the model for each request. General availability in U.S. regions is expected in winter 2026.

The two companies post-trained it from Nvidia's open-weight Nemotron 3 Super for selling, marketing and customer-support work; Koa's weights stay with Salesforce, which runs the model inside its own infrastructure.

Jayesh Govindarajan, Salesforce's executive vice president for AI, told [TechCrunch](https://techcrunch.com/2026/09/15/salesforce-and-nvidias-new-reasoning-model-is-everything-the-ai-labs-should-fear/?ref=metatalks.ai) that the company had built many small models for specific Agentforce jobs. He cited training-data provenance as a reason for choosing Nemotron, and said Salesforce did not know what data Alibaba's Qwen was trained on.

No customer data went into the post-training. The companies built synthetic stand-ins instead, simulating interactions from furious callers to a salesperson pushing to close a deal.

Salesforce's own tests, reported in the paper published with the model, put Koa's overall CRM Bench score above GPT-4.1's and below those of Claude Opus 4.8 and GPT-5.5.

In August Salesforce announced Claudeforce, a partnership with Anthropic under which companies can use Claude as their AI front end while their data stays in Salesforce's system of record.
